Transforming Ideas into Mobile Apps: The Development Journey
Embarking on the adventure of mobile app development is a thrilling experience. It involves a structured system that takes an initial idea and molds it into a functional and engaging mobile application available on the App Store. The first stage often focuses on thorough market research to identify user needs and define app functionality. This phase culminates in a thorough project plan that maps out the development schedule.
- Next, the design phase introduces the user interface (UI) and user experience (UX). Designers craft wireframes, mockups, and prototypes to visualize the app's feel and functionality.
- Alongside, developers launch into the coding process, using programming languages like Swift or Java to build the app's foundation. They implement various APIs to enable key features and functionalities.
- During development, rigorous testing is essential to ensure the app's stability, performance, and user-friendliness. Developers execute a range of tests, including unit tests, integration tests, and user acceptance testing (UAT), to pinpoint any problems.
When the app has been thoroughly tested and refined, it's ready for submission to the App Store. Developers submit their app, providing all necessary information and complying with Apple's policies.
Ultimately, the product is examined by Apple's team to verify it meets quality and security standards. If approved, the app goes live for download on the App Store, connecting with a global audience of potential users.
